Output 30712b23d8c99c23207932b0721c20ca60acaf0605125e7fcdc3ed401eee9474:1

value
152486002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fb58df839eddd293b4ddf4fda973569ff66a44 OP_EQUAL
address
354ZMMdcP5HR8F37oyw6JJerY87cqY4NDQ
transaction
30712b23d8c99c23207932b0721c20ca60acaf0605125e7fcdc3ed401eee9474
spent
true